p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/audio/eawpatches Fixed file permissions for gravis.cfg.



details:   https://anonhg.NetBSD.org/pkgsrc/rev/c7baf17cb339
branches:  trunk
changeset: 523517:c7baf17cb339
user:      rillig <rillig%pkgsrc.org@localhost>
date:      Mon Jan 08 21:34:57 2007 +0000

description:
Fixed file permissions for gravis.cfg.

Reordered things in the Makefile.

PKGREVISION++

diffstat:

 audio/eawpatches/Makefile |  26 ++++++++++++++------------
 1 files changed, 14 insertions(+), 12 deletions(-)

diffs (47 lines):

diff -r b5ec7605f183 -r c7baf17cb339 audio/eawpatches/Makefile
--- a/audio/eawpatches/Makefile Mon Jan 08 21:12:31 2007 +0000
+++ b/audio/eawpatches/Makefile Mon Jan 08 21:34:57 2007 +0000
@@ -1,9 +1,9 @@
-# $NetBSD: Makefile,v 1.18 2006/10/27 13:45:44 drochner Exp $
+# $NetBSD: Makefile,v 1.19 2007/01/08 21:34:57 rillig Exp $
 #
 
 DISTNAME=      eawpats12_full
 PKGNAME=       eawpatches-12
-PKGREVISION=   2
+PKGREVISION=   3
 CATEGORIES=    audio
 MASTER_SITES=  ${MASTER_SITE_GENTOO:=distfiles/}
 
@@ -15,19 +15,21 @@
 NO_BIN_ON_CDROM=       ${RESTRICTED}
 LICENSE=       generic-nonlicense
 
-USE_TOOLS+=    gzcat tar
-EXTRACT_ONLY=  # empty
-NO_CONFIGURE=  yes
+WRKSRC=                ${WRKDIR}
 NO_BUILD=      yes
 MESSAGE_SUBST+=        PKG_SYSCONFDIR=${PKG_SYSCONFDIR}
 
+post-extract:
+       chmod go-w ${WRKSRC}/eawpats/gravis.cfg
+
+pre-configure:
+       sed -e "s@/home/user/eawpats@${WRKSRC}/share/eawpats@" \
+               < ${WRKSRC}/eawpats/linuxconfig/timidity.cfg \
+               > ${WRKSRC}/eawpats/timidity.cfg
+       rm -r ${WRKSRC}/eawpats/linuxconfig \
+               ${WRKSRC}/eawpats/winconfig
+
 do-install:
-       cd ${PREFIX}/share && \
-               gzcat ${DISTDIR}/${DISTNAME}${EXTRACT_SUFX} | tar xf -
-       ${SED}  -e "s@/home/user/eawpats@${PREFIX}/share/eawpats@" \
-               < ${PREFIX}/share/eawpats/linuxconfig/timidity.cfg \
-               > ${PREFIX}/share/eawpats/timidity.cfg
-       ${RM} -r ${PREFIX}/share/eawpats/linuxconfig \
-               ${PREFIX}/share/eawpats/winconfig
+       cd ${WRKSRC} && pax -wr eawpats ${PREFIX}/share
 
 .include "../../mk/bsd.pkg.mk"



Home | Main Index | Thread Index | Old Index